Ingredients for Raspberry Matcha Pound Cake

Gather these items:

  • 1 cup Salted butter
  • 1 cup Granulated sugar
  • 1 teaspoon Vanilla extract
  • 3 large Eggs
  • 2 cups All-pur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on Kosher salt
  • 2 cups Fresh raspberries
  • 2 teaspoons Granulated sugar
  • 2 tablespoons Ceremonial grade matcha powder

How to Make Raspberry Matcha Pound Cake Step-by-Step

  1. Step 1: Preheat the oven to 350°F.
  2. Step 2: Beat the butter, sugar, and vanilla extract together in a stand mixer for 4-5 minutes.
  3. Step 3: Add the eggs one at a time, beating on medium speed until fully incorporated.
  4. Step 4: Mix in the flour and kosher salt on low speed until just combined.
  5. Step 5: Smash the raspberries with 2 teaspoons of granulated sugar until they form a paste.
  6. Step 6: Swirl the raspberry paste into the batter gently, then swirl in the matcha powder.
  7. Step 7: Line a 9-inch loaf tin with parchment paper, then pour in the batter.
  8. Step 8: Bake for 55-65 minutes, until a toothpick comes out clean.
  9. Step 9: Allow to cool before serving.

How to Store and Reheat Raspberry Matcha Pound Cake

To keep your cake fresh, wrap it tightly in plastic wrap or store it in an airtight container. You can also freeze slices for later enjoyment. To reheat, pop a slice in the microwave for about 10-15 seconds.

Frequently Asked Questions About Raspberry Matcha Pound Cake

What’s the secret to perfect Raspberry Matcha Pound Cake?

The key is to ensure your ingredients are at room temperature, which helps create a lighter texture, and to not overmix the batter, allowing for a tender crumb.

Can I make Raspberry Matcha Pound Cake ahead of time?

Yes! This cake can be made a day in advance. Just store it in an airtight container at room temperature for the best flavor and texture.

How do I avoid common mistakes with Raspberry Matcha Pound Cake?

Make sure to measure your ingredients accurately and avoid over-mixing the batter. This will help prevent a dense or tough cake.
